Incident Overview

Date: Thursday 21 September 1944
Aircraft Type: Douglas Dakota III (DC-3)
Owner/operator: 437 Sqn RCAF
Registration Number: KG376
Location: SW of Keldonk, Noord-Brabant – ÿ Netherlands
Phase of Flight: Combat
Status: Destroyed, written off
Casualties: Fatalities: 3 / Occupants: 8

Description

Shot down during Operation Market Garden. Crew bailed out, but three were killed. Takeoff at 13.14 LT for a re-supply mission.
